"Friendly place"
Overall Resort Rating:
Sa Coma is a small resort compared to Cala Millor, the next one along for example. There's some good restaurants here and there's a few bars too. You get live entertainment in some of them (King's Head, Delaneys and Britannia bar) there's other smaller, quieter bars if you prefer and these ones don't open as late. The ones in brackets above tend to be 3am but the others are around 12 or 1am. The beach is fantastic and the seas is shallow for a good bit out, excellent for swimming in. There's plenty watersports to choose from and there's bars/restaurants along the back of it for refreshments. There is also a train/tractor vehicle that takes you to Cala Millor of a couple of euros if you want a more varied choice of things to do and it only takes around 15 mins to get there. Sa Coma is nice, the locals are quite friendly so it was a very enjoyable experience for us.

"sa coma"
Overall Resort Rating:
Sa coma is lovely for families and couples. We stayed at bouganvilla park which is a 20 min walk athough the train does operate during the day. Due to the high value of the euro. eating out is now expensive. although there are a large selection of restaurants to choose from. A beer now averages £3.00 and a coke £2.00 . A coffee and cake £3.00. The beach is sandy and neighbouring Sillot has loads of rockpools for the kids to explore. Activities are expensive the 54 hole mini golf is 12 euros per person. soon mounts up for a family of 4 £45.00.

"seemed nice"
Overall Resort Rating:
Didn't see much of the resort with being AI and only visited the beach a few times for the same reason. The beaches were astoundingly clean and there seemed plenty of sunbeds (charged locally of course). Didn't purchase food or drink but shops were nice. used hotel entertainment in evening so unsure of nightlife. There is a safari park within walking distance of the hotel that worth a look, cost £40 for family of 4. Kids had enjoyable day. Also a horse ranch just opposite the beach where you can hire a pony for 10euros for your child and you are given the leash and can head of for a stroll to the castle. We walked with the ponies for over an hour and still didn't reach the castle and had to turn back as it was far too hot! but good experience for the kids.
